Great Lakes Yellow Perch Fishing with John Hageman

from 120 Outdoors Podcast · host Chris DePaola and Don Clowes

Yellow Perch Fishing with John HagemanRetired Stone Lab professor, award-winning outdoor writer, and avid angler John Hageman joins the podcast to discuss the decline of yellow perch populations and why Lake Erie’s western basin remains a perch stronghold. We cover spawning habits, the impact of spiny water fleas, and John’s favorite perch fishing setup, along with some of his recommended locations.If you’re interested in Great Lakes yellow perch, this episode is for you.
